Stuart started playing Touch Football in Western Australia in under 16s before moving to Sydney in 2004 to play Vawdon Cup. He made his debut for Australia in the Men’s Open Trans Tasman in 2009 in Wollongong. Stuart has won 2 consecutive Trans Tasman Series against New Zealand and the 2011 Touch Football World Cup in Scotland.
